Replacing Manual Catalog Publishing
Before implementing CourseLeaf CAT in 2017, staff maintained three separate versions of the academic catalog: the online catalog, the PDF catalog, and Ellucian Banner. Late curriculum changes often delayed publication, and mismatched prerequisites and corequisites required additional review before the catalog could be finalized.
With CourseLeaf CAT, faculty and staff could publish approved catalog updates across all formats simultaneously, improving efficiency and increasing confidence in the accuracy of academic information.
The impact was measurable:
- Reduced catalog publication from 11 months to 9 months
- Increased catalog website visits by 61%
- Increased average visitor engagement by nearly 18%
- Supported overall enrollment growth of more than 14%
Expanding a Successful Partnership
Following the success of CourseLeaf CAT, TAMIU implemented CourseLeaf CIM for curriculum management and later CourseLeaf CLSS for academic scheduling.
Before CLSS, scheduling relied heavily on spreadsheets and manual Banner data entry.
"We were sending Excel files around campus," recalled Juan Gilberto Garcia Jr., Associate Vice President of Student Success.
Although the university had developed sophisticated spreadsheet processes, maintaining them remained time consuming.
"We took advantage of everything that Excel can do. We created a very nice Excel sheet, with a lot of colors and drop-down menus and things like that… but then we still had to move the data to Banner and do our cross-checks and cross-referencing, which led to errors," said Garcia.
As enrollment and faculty continued to grow, the scheduling process became increasingly difficult to manage.
"It became very hard for one person to do the scheduling," said Garcia. "We wanted to remove ourselves from the data entry. And we wanted to reduce our time to create the class schedule from six weeks to four weeks."
CourseLeaf CLSS provided the flexibility and automation TAMIU needed to streamline scheduling while reducing manual work and improving data accuracy.
Creating More Time for Students
Reducing administrative work was only part of the benefit. Completing the schedule earlier created more opportunities for advisors to work directly with students before registration.
"Our students benefited the most from our adoption of CLSS," said Garcia. "And their advisors. Reducing the schedule creation timeline by two weeks means those two weeks can be put to better use, with students and their advisors meeting during that period."
Those additional two weeks translated into meaningful advising opportunities.
Reflecting on the impact, Garcia said, "We were neglecting the human side of advising. But now, two extra weeks to schedule our students across campus… that's 10 extra working days, and that represents a lot of advising appointment opportunities."
Instead of spending time managing spreadsheets and correcting scheduling data, staff could focus on helping students plan their academic paths.
Responding Quickly to Change
The value of connected scheduling became even more apparent during the COVID-19 pandemic.
As the university shifted courses from in-person to online instruction, CLSS enabled scheduling decisions to be made in real time while staff worked remotely.
"We had hoped to re-open our campus for the fall," said Garcia, "but we couldn't, and we had to make changes to the class schedules. With people working from home, having CLSS helped us tremendously as the ones who were making scheduling decisions were able to make changes right away, in real time, without waiting for a middle person to do it."
The university managed an unprecedented number of scheduling changes without relying on manual processes.
"A lot of faculty members decided or asked to teach from home. A lot of classes changed from face-to-face to online. Because we were already live with CLSS, we were able to manage the unprecedented number of schedule changes forced by COVID," recalled Garcia.
